Dr. Domenic V. Cicchetti stands as a preeminent scholar in the application of statistical methodologies to psychological and psychiatric assessment instruments. He maintains distinguished professorial appointments across multiple departments at Yale University, including Biometry, the Child Study Center, and Psychiatry, demonstrating the interdisciplinary nature of his scholarly contributions. Having earned his doctoral degree in biostatistics from the University of Connecticut, Dr. Cicchetti established his reputation through significant contributions to measurement science while serving as Senior Research Scientist at the Yale Child Study Center. His career has been defined by a rigorous approach to enhancing the scientific validity of clinical assessment tools across mental health research domains.
Dr. Cicchetti's most influential contributions center on the development and refinement of statistical frameworks for evaluating reliability and validity in clinical rating scales and diagnostic instruments. His seminal work on inter-rater reliability, particularly concerning the kappa statistic and its applications, has provided researchers with essential methodological tools for quantifying agreement beyond chance in observational assessments.
